An unusual brass cased Matthew Norman four dial carriage clock. The 2.5-inch silvered Roman chapter ring with blued steel Breguet hands, framing central moon phase and above three subsidiary dials for days of the week, alarm and date, the four-pillar two-train movement with lever platform escapement striking on a coiled gong, the back plate inscribed 'Eleven Jewels Unadjusted Swiss Made', 'Movement Matthew Norman Switzerland 1981', in unusual brass case having folding split handles to top, and campaign style fittings to sides, 5.75" (14.5cm) high excluding height of handles.

Dial in good condition. Movement appears sound, untested. Case displaying signs of tarnishing and wear and surface marks commensurate with age and use. Possible replacement handles/alterations, no evidence of base plinth.
